WebWild Bunch was a crew of hitmen for the Chicago Outfit criminal organization during the 1970s and 1980s. [1] [2] The crew planned and carried out multiple murders for the Chicago Outfit. They reported to the Outfit boss Joseph Ferriola. Information about the Wild Bunch crew came into light in Operation Family Secrets investigations. [3] [2] Members
